BMS Characters and Modular Invariance

abstract

We construct the characters for the highest weight representations of the 3d Bondi-Metzner-Sachs (BMS$_3$) algebra. We then use these to construct the partition function and show how to use BMS modular transformations to obtain a density of primary states. The entropy thus obtained accounts for the principle part of the entropy obtained from the BMS-Cardy formula. This suggests that BMS primaries capture most of the entropy of Flat Space Cosmologies, which are the flatspace analogues of BTZ black holes in AdS$_3$. We reproduce our character formula by looking at singular limits from 2d CFT characters and find that our answers are identical to the characters obtained for the very different induced representations. We offer an algebraic explanation to this arising from a (to the best of our knowledge) novel automorphism in the parent 2d CFT.
